About Robert Neppach

  • Robert Neppach (2 March 1890 – 18 August 1939) was an Austrian architect, film producer and art director.
  • Neppach worked from 1919 in the German film industry.
  • He oversaw the art direction of over eighty films during his career, including F.W.
  • Murnau's Desire (1921) and Richard Oswald's Lucrezia Borgia (1922).
  • Neppach was comparatively unusual among set designers during the era in having university training.In 1932 he switched to concentrate on film production.
  • In May 1933, his first Jewish wife Nelly, a successful tennis player, took her life because of the discrimination and prosecution of Jews in Nazi Germany.
  • He married Grete Walter, daughter of the composer Bruno Walter, in autumn of 1933.
  • With his Jewish wife, life grew increasingly difficult for him under the Nazis.
  • He began to work as an architect again and the couple emigrated to Switzerland.
  • In 1939, shortly before the outbreak of the Second World War, he shot himself and his wife.
